- Support for logging levels using environmental variable `WETTER_LOG` - Documentation to the code base - Testdata matching to the new schema - Tests for edge cases w/o historical data - Tests for the configuration modules. - Tests for cli application
Changed
- Internal structure of the library. Now representing better separation
Updated
- Formatting of output by cli application
0.3.1
Added
- MIT license - CLI subcommand `compare --month X` as `compare-details` alternative - CLI subcommand `config` for printing configuration and systemd/cron setup - Configuration module - Definition of the serialization structure for backend - Parser for serialization structure via custom `json.JSONEncoder` - API for Historical Data from OpenMeteo Archive
Fixed
- Bug in `compared-details` method
Removed
- Testdata from the package - CLI subcommand `compare-details`
Updated
- Documentation for the package - Tests for the backend system - Tests for the configuration management
0.3.0
Added
- MVP of the main tasks for comparison and latest measurement as well as update
Changed
- Restructuring of the code backend
0.2.0rc.1
Added
- CI/CD workflow for release creation - CI/CD workflow for static analysis - CI/CD workflow for build, install and test - Test data from OpenMeteo - Scaffolding for CLI tool - Setup of Dockerfile and Makefile